A coding-agent skill for Tracearr, a monitoring service for Plex, Jellyfin, and Emby media servers.

In plain words
What is it for?
Use it for active-stream monitoring, stream analytics, account-sharing detection, alerts, imports from Tautulli or Jellystat, Docker deployment, plugin setup, and Tracearr API work.
Why use it?
It gives developers guidance for investigating media-server activity, configuring Tracearr, and connecting related monitoring data.

Per session 63 Skills are progressive disclosure: only the name and description are preloaded; the body loads when the skill is used.
When invoked 1,004 The whole file, excluding the scripts and references it only reads on demand.
Security scan A 1 finding. A grade says what 26 rules found in the file — not that it is safe.
Origin unknown No closer match found in the catalogue.

tracearr scanned grade A with 1 finding against 26 rules in 11 categories — prompt injection, anti-refusal, data exfiltration, privilege escalation, supply chain, agent snooping, system-prompt leakage, SSRF and excessive agency — measured 8d ago.

The scan reads SKILL.md. This mod also ships 2 executable files (scripts/load-config.sh, scripts/tracearr-api.sh), listed below but not scanned — reading those needs a real analyzer, not pattern matching.

A static scan of the body, not an audit. Every finding is printed with the line that produced it so you can judge whether it matters here. A mod is markdown that instructs an agent; that is exactly why what it instructs is worth reading.
